Abraham Jebediah “Abe” Simpson II, more often referred to as Grampa Simpson, is the stereotypical senile grandparent. Living at Springfield Retirement Castle, he is known for waffling on, telling strange stories that are unlikely to be true.
Dan Castellaneta voices both Abe and Homer. Grampa Simpson has married and divorced several women – one of them even being Homer’s sister-in-law Selma – and is father to Homer and two additional illegitimate children.
For this Simpsons character, Matt Groening actually decided not to name Grampa Simpson after any of his relatives; however, in the most crazy of coincidences, the writers chose the name Abraham which just so happened to be his own grandfather’s name.
